About the role
This is a key role supporting regulatory, quality assurance and accreditation functions for both individual and organisational members. You will contribute to maintaining high professional standards and protecting the public.
Working closely with the Regulation and Quality Assurance Manager, you will help coordinate and deliver a range of regulatory and accreditation activities, with a particular focus on education and accreditation pathways.
Key responsibilities include:
- Supporting audits, quality reviews and accreditation processes
- Ensuring regulatory frameworks are applied consistently and proportionately
- Managing complex information and maintaining accurate records
- Drafting clear reports and supporting documentation
- Contributing to the continuous improvement of regulatory processes
- Liaising with a wide range of stakeholders including colleagues, committees, volunteers and subject matter experts
This is a structured, specialist role suited to someone who values fairness, consistency and sound judgement.

About the organisation
The organisation is a leading professional body representing psychotherapists and psychotherapeutic counsellors across the UK. It works to promote high standards in education, training and professional practice, while supporting research and improving access to psychotherapy.
With a large and diverse membership spanning private practice, the NHS and the voluntary sector, the organisation plays a key role in upholding standards and acting in the public interest.
